Pupils evaluate ideas, solutions, or issues based on the pros and cons of each.
The method helps pupils explore and select the best ideas, solutions, or issues.
Pupils choose an idea, solution, or issue they wish to evaluate.
They each write down at least 3 things that speak for and 3 things that speak against the idea, solution, or issue on the Pros and Cons worksheet
When everyone in the group has written pros and cons for the idea, the students can repeat the process with a new idea, solution, or issue.
The pupils share their pros and cons and decide which idea(s), solution(s), or issue(s) they want to discard and which they want to continue working on.
If pupils need to justify their choice of idea, they can subsequently assess its value using the Value Compass method.
This method works well in combination with the worksheet For and Against.
